Why a secure NDAX login matters

Your NDAX login unlocks access to sensitive account settings, deposit and withdrawal capabilities, and trading permissions. Because centralized exchanges hold custody of assets on behalf of users, unauthorized access can result in rapid fund movement or account manipulation. A secure login reduces these risks and establishes a baseline of protection—using strong credentials, 2FA, device recognition, and careful habits to avoid phishing attempts.

Two-factor authentication (2FA): strategic setup

Two-factor authentication drastically reduces the chance of a takeover using only a stolen password. Recommended practices:

  • Prefer an authenticator app over SMS. Authenticator apps are not vulnerable to SIM-swapping.
  • Securely store backup/recovery codes. NDAX may provide recovery codes during 2FA setup — write them down and keep them offline.
  • Consider multi-device 2FA (e.g., primary phone + secure hardware) if available through your authenticator app provider.

Password hygiene & account hardening

A long unique password protects you from credential-stuffing and simple brute-force attacks. Tips:

  • Create a long passphrase (three or more unrelated words + symbols) or use a password manager to generate a unique password for NDAX.
  • Enable login alerts and monitor account activity for unknown IPs or devices.
  • Enable withdrawal whitelists or IP whitelisting if NDAX offers these features for your account tier.

Recognize and avoid phishing attempts

Phishing is the most common way attackers harvest login credentials. Protect yourself by:

  • Never entering credentials on pages that don’t match ndax.io exactly — watch for homograph or typosquatting domains.
  • Verifying emails come from an @ndax.io address; be cautious of urgent-sounding password reset emails.
  • Using bookmarks instead of search results or links in messages to reach NDAX.

Troubleshooting common login issues

If you can’t access your account, try the following:

  • Forgot your password? Use NDAX’s “Forgot password” flow at ndax.io/login to reset via your verified email.
  • Lost 2FA device? Use your stored recovery codes to regain access. If you can’t, contact NDAX support for account recovery guidance and be prepared to supply identity verification documentation.
  • Account locked: Too many failed attempts may temporarily block login. Wait the cooldown or contact support if you need immediate access.

If you suspect account compromise

Act fast if something looks wrong:

  • Immediately change your NDAX password from a secure device.
  • Revoke any connected API keys and session tokens.
  • Contact NDAX Support (see links below) and follow their incident guidance.
  • Check withdrawal addresses and trading history; notify NDAX support of unauthorized activity.

Safe device and network practices

Secure devices and networks reduce risk significantly:

  • Keep your OS, browser, and antivirus up to date.
  • Avoid public or untrusted Wi-Fi when logging in — use a reputable VPN when necessary.
  • Use a dedicated browser profile for financial accounts to limit extension exposure.
